Abstract

A protector for a portable electronic device is provided. The protector includes a substrate having a first surface and a second surface, a first material disposed on the first surface, and a second material disposed on the second surface. The first material's edge is folded to stick on the second surface between the second material and the substrate.

Please refer to FIG. 1 , which is a schematic diagram of a protective case of a conventional technology. A protective case 1 is disclosed, which is divided into left and right parts by a bent portion 13, and an electronic article 2 is mounted on the right side, most of which is occupied by the screen 20, thereby being visible because the screen 20 is transparent, easily broken, and easy. It is wear and dirt, so it is necessary to protect the case 1 for protection. The portion of the protective casing 1 located to the left of the bent portion 13 can be covered on the screen 20 to provide protection. The bent portion 13 is present in order to open the protective case 1 as a book, but still can be kept in one piece, and in order to prevent the protective case 1 from being bent inward by the external force, the electronic article 2 is damaged. Inside the protective case 1 is a substrate 10 (shown by a broken line in Fig. 1), which is usually made of a hard material, and is disposed in the protective case 1 from left to right. In order to save weight and space, the bent portion is 13 is usually only composed of cloth 11 without the use of a hinge. The size of the cloth 11 is sufficient to cover two side-by-side substrates 10, and the cloth 11 is sandwiched between the front and the bottom of the substrate 10, and the cloth 11 is large to the center to retain a certain width so that the front and rear two pieces of fabric 11 can Direct contact, so that the center portion naturally forms a bent portion 13 due to the fact that the cloth 11 itself is suitable for the reverse bending property.

為了讓前後兩片的布料11可以將基板10固定於兩者之間,因此,延伸至基板10外的布料11則前後兩片直接接合,通常是以超音波融接的方式行之,因此,習用技術的保護殼1自身的周圍會形成閉合部12。請參閱揭露相關構造的A-A剖面的圖2。 In order to allow the front and back two pieces of the cloth 11 to fix the substrate 10 therebetween, the cloth 11 extending outside the substrate 10 is directly joined to the front and back, and is usually ultrasonically coupled. A closed portion 12 is formed around the protective casing 1 of the prior art. See Figure 2 for the A-A section of the related construction.

請參閱圖2,為圖1的A-A的局部剖面圖。其中可見基板10具有一第一面101與一第二面102,前述的布料11則分為貼設於第一面101的第一面料111與貼設於第二面102的第二面料112,且此二面料(111、112)在基板10的邊緣處互相黏合而形成一閉合部12,類似水餃皮的構造。由此可見,閉合部12內沒有基板10之存在,亦即只有布料的結構在,雖然通常是採用質地較硬的布料,且由於此閉合部12也通常採用超音波融接的方式,故而閉合部12的材料密度與韌性是比較高的,但是在較長期使用之後,由於擠壓與碰撞等緣故,閉合部12必定會產生皺摺、彎曲、挫曲等現象,嚴重時閉合部12還會裂開、即第一面料111與第二面料112相互分離。此外,由於閉合部12是比較薄的,因此偶有割傷使用者的狀況產生。 Please refer to FIG. 2, which is a partial cross-sectional view of A-A of FIG. 1. The substrate 10 has a first surface 101 and a second surface 102. The cloth 11 is divided into a first fabric 111 attached to the first surface 101 and a second fabric 112 attached to the second surface 102. And the two fabrics (111, 112) are bonded to each other at the edge of the substrate 10 to form a closed portion 12, similar to the construction of the dumpling skin. It can be seen that there is no substrate 10 in the closed portion 12, that is, only the structure of the cloth is present, although a hard fabric is usually used, and since the closing portion 12 is usually ultrasonically coupled, it is closed. The material density and toughness of the portion 12 are relatively high, but after a long period of use, due to the pressing and collision, the closing portion 12 must have wrinkles, bends, buckling, etc., and in the severe case, the closed portion 12 The split, that is, the first fabric 111 and the second fabric 112 are separated from each other. Further, since the closing portion 12 is relatively thin, occasionally a condition of the user is cut.

請參閱圖4,為圖1的B-B的局部剖面圖。其中,基板10具有一第一面101與一第二面102,而面料3’更分為一貼設於第一面101的第一面料31,與一貼設於第二面102的第二面料32,第一面料31尚具有一周緣部31a,是貼著基板10的邊緣直接翻摺並與第二面貼合,且周緣部31a位於基板10與第二面料32之間,亦即第二面料32是貼合在基板10的第二面102與周緣部31a上。此外,通常各面料是以熱融接技術與基板10做永久性的結合,因此,在第一面料31上欲與基板10結合之面會形成一熱融膠層、或含有熱融膠,而第二面料32上欲與基板10以及周緣部31a結合之面亦會形成一熱融膠層、或含有熱融膠。而在進行膠合作業時,可以將第一面料31、周緣部31a、第二面料32、以及基板10四個元件的位置確定後,以單一次的熱壓合作業將之作永久性的結合;或是可以先將第一面料31與基板10的第一面101進行熱壓合、再將周緣部31a與基板10的第二面102進行熱壓合、最後,將第二面料32與基板10的第二面102及周緣部31a進行熱壓合;此外,亦可以先將第一面101與第一面料31相接觸、之後將周緣部31a翻摺而與第二面102接觸、再將第一面料31與第一面101並同時將第二面102與周緣部31a進行熱壓合、之後再將第二面料32透過熱壓合作業永久性的結合在第二面102與周緣部31a上。圖4中各面料所繪成的厚度僅是為了方便辨識,實際上面料的厚度是一定比例的薄於基板。 Please refer to FIG. 4, which is a partial cross-sectional view of B-B of FIG. 1. The substrate 10 has a first surface 101 and a second surface 102, and the fabric 3' is further divided into a first fabric 31 attached to the first surface 101 and a second surface disposed on the second surface 102. The fabric 32 has a peripheral edge portion 31a which is folded over the edge of the substrate 10 and is bonded to the second surface, and the peripheral edge portion 31a is located between the substrate 10 and the second fabric 32. The second fabric 32 is bonded to the second surface 102 and the peripheral edge portion 31a of the substrate 10. In addition, in general, each fabric is permanently bonded to the substrate 10 by a thermal fusion technique. Therefore, a surface to be bonded to the substrate 10 on the first fabric 31 may form a hot melt adhesive layer or contain a hot melt adhesive. The surface of the second fabric 32 to be bonded to the substrate 10 and the peripheral portion 31a may also form a hot melt adhesive layer or contain a hot melt adhesive. In the rubber bonding industry, the positions of the four components of the first fabric 31, the peripheral portion 31a, the second fabric 32, and the substrate 10 can be determined, and then permanently combined by a single hot pressing cooperation; Alternatively, the first fabric 31 may be thermally pressed together with the first surface 101 of the substrate 10, and the peripheral portion 31a and the second surface 102 of the substrate 10 may be thermocompression bonded. Finally, the second fabric 32 and the substrate 10 are bonded. The second surface 102 and the peripheral edge portion 31a are thermocompression-bonded. Alternatively, the first surface 101 may be brought into contact with the first fabric 31, and then the peripheral edge portion 31a may be folded over to be in contact with the second surface 102. A fabric 31 and the first surface 101 simultaneously heat-press the second surface 102 and the peripheral edge portion 31a, and then the second fabric 32 is permanently bonded to the second surface 102 and the peripheral portion 31a through the hot press cooperation. . The thickness of each fabric in Figure 4 is only for the convenience of identification. In fact, the thickness of the fabric is a certain proportion thinner than the substrate.

綜上所述,本發明「隨身電子用品的保護體及其製造方法」就是捨棄了習用技術形似餃類食物麵皮的閉合部,因為此閉合部形成了一個凸出於基板外甚多的結構,此結構構成了習用技術的保護殼的邊緣,但由於容易被碰撞到而導致閉合部的彎曲、變形,而且增加了整個保護殼的尺寸。因此,本發明是將正反面的兩個面料的其中之一設計為具有周緣部的結構,並將周緣部沿著基板邊緣由基板的一面翻摺到基板的另一面,並由另一面料覆蓋翻摺後的周緣部與基板,如此即不再需要習用的閉合部之類的結構,因此,當本發明的保護體的側邊遭受擠壓、碰撞時,可以由基板直接承受外力,而不會像習用的閉合部產生彎曲、皺摺、甚至是分離的現象,而且由於沒有閉合部,本發明的保護體的尺寸可以再小一些,長久使用後也不會有皺摺的閉合部因而更加的凸顯美觀。再者,本案使用熱壓合的技術來盡可能的提高使用壽命、即提高耐用度,而本案熱壓合的最低溫度是攝氏一百度,而最高溫則是攝氏一百九十度,即溫度區間是攝氏一百度至一百九十度。可見本發明對於應用於隨身攜帶的電子用品如手機或平板電腦的保護裝置、以及保護裝置的製造方法,均具有莫大的貢獻。 In summary, the "protective body of the portable electronic article and the manufacturing method thereof" of the present invention is to abandon the closed portion of the conventionally shaped dumpling-like food dough, because the closed portion forms a structure protruding from the substrate, This structure constitutes the edge of the protective casing of the conventional technique, but is bent and deformed due to the easy collision, and increases the size of the entire protective casing. Therefore, in the present invention, one of the two fabrics of the front and back sides is designed to have a peripheral portion structure, and the peripheral portion is folded from one side of the substrate to the other side of the substrate along the edge of the substrate, and covered by another fabric. The folded peripheral portion and the substrate, so that the structure such as the conventional closed portion is no longer needed, and therefore, when the side of the protective body of the present invention is subjected to pressing and collision, the external force can be directly received by the substrate without The phenomenon of bending, wrinkling, and even separation occurs like a conventional closed portion, and since there is no closed portion, the size of the protective body of the present invention can be made smaller, and there is no wrinkled closed portion after long-term use, and thus The appearance is beautiful. In addition, this case uses the hot pressing technology to improve the service life as much as possible, that is, to improve the durability, and the lowest temperature of the hot pressing in this case is one hundred degrees Celsius, and the highest temperature is one hundred and ninety degrees Celsius, that is, the temperature. The interval is from one bai to one hundred and ninety degrees Celsius. It can be seen that the present invention has a great contribution to the protection device for electronic products such as mobile phones or tablets that are carried around, and the manufacturing method of the protection device.
